Martray Manor, 19 Martray Road, Martray
County Tyrone

Symmetrical 2 storey, 5 bay house on plinth course. Central bay has slim gabled breakfront with octagonal stone finial. Fronted by large rectangular stone porch with crenellations. Mullioned windows, side door with carved spandrels and hood-mould enclosing coat of arms. Sash windows on each floor. Gable ends have modern bay extensions

Stonework Construction: | Regular-coursed plain ashlar |
Stonework Condition: | Sandstone blockwork is in reasonable condition but with some evidence of isolated stone block deterioration and surface loss through scaling, flaking and granular disintegration. |
